Latest Patents
Vennesa holds a patent for a room temperature curable organopolysiloxane composition. This composition includes an organopolysiloxane with alkoxysilyl-containing groups at both molecular terminals, an organopolysiloxane resin, an alkoxysilane, and a condensation-reaction catalyst. The resulting product exhibits good to excellent storage stability and can form a cured product with impressive mechanical properties.
